#!/usr/bin/env python
from setuptools import setup
import colors
setup(
name='ansicolors',
version='1.1.8',
description='ANSI colors for Python',
long_description=open('README.rst').read(),
author='Giorgos Verigakis',
author_email='verigak@gmail.com',
maintainer='Jonathan Eunice',
maintainer_email='jonathan.eunice@gmail.com',
url='http://github.com/jonathaneunice/colors/',
license='ISC',
packages=['colors'],
install_requires=[],
test_requore=['tox', 'pytest', 'coverage', 'pytest-cov'],
test_suite="test",
zip_safe=False,
keywords='ASNI color style console',
classifiers=[
'Environment :: Console',
'Operating System :: OS Independent',
'Intended Audience :: Developers',
'License :: OSI Approved :: ISC License (ISCL)',
'Programming Language :: Python',
'Programming Language :: Python :: 2',
'Programming Language :: Python :: 2.6',
'Programming Language :: Python :: 2.7',
'Programming Language :: Python :: 3',
'Programming Language :: Python :: 3.3',
'Programming Language :: Python :: 3.4',
'Programming Language :: Python :: 3.5',
'Programming Language :: Python :: 3.6',
'Programming Language :: Python :: Implementation :: CPython',
'Programming Language :: Python :: Implementation :: PyPy',
'Topic :: Software Development :: Libraries :: Python Modules'
]
)
